Output d500a0c44c295a8a958860644a430106bfbb903695b15c8ac8a5d052d0f4ddb5:1

value
5232436
script pubkey
OP_0 OP_PUSHBYTES_20 dad99ec8f24c9c5f425a77528b0436dc70be35f6
address
bc1qmtveaj8jfjw97sj6wafgkppkm3ctud0kmzzna3
transaction
d500a0c44c295a8a958860644a430106bfbb903695b15c8ac8a5d052d0f4ddb5
confirmations
187412
spent
true